Whereas a suspension is set for a certain period of time and the driver regains privileges once the time has lapsed, a revocation may continue for years and the driver can only have driving privileges restored through a hearing or other administrative procedure. However, for young drivers under age 21, the points cannot be avoided with a nolo plea, and a conviction of reckless driving in Georgia suspends for six (6) months. Whereas a charge of distracted driving indicates that a driver's attention was on something other than driving (and assumed to have been without intent to harm), reckless driving by its very nature indicates a driver's wanton disregard for other drivers and pedestrians. March 1, 2023 at 1:05 pm. 4 min. that could be potentially hazardous is the differentiator between it being considered careless or reckless. A careless driver may swerve while petting their puppy in the passenger seat, while a reckless driver speeds or tailgates another driver with disregard for their safety. In Georgia, drivers who are impaired by alcohol, drugs, or a combination of the two can be charged with driving under the influence (DUI) in two different ways: "DUI-less-safe," also called "impairment DUI," and DUI "per se.". Plus, anolo contendereplea (if obtained) can mean zero points being added at the DDS GA (the Georgia Department of Driver Services). WebThe judge can sentence you to spend up to 12 months in the county jail. For a 17-year-old driver, 4 points within 12 months suspends, and for adult drivers 15 or more points within the last 24 months suspends.
